2392ae7d73 Implement rdar://7860110 (also in target/readme.txt) narrowing
a load/or/and/store sequence into a narrower store when it is
safe.  Daniel tells me that clang will start producing this sort
of thing with bitfields, and this does  trigger a few dozen times
on 176.gcc produced by llvm-gcc even now.

This compiles code like CodeGen/X86/2009-05-28-DAGCombineCrash.ll 
into:

        movl    %eax, 36(%rdi)

instead of:

        movl    $4294967295, %eax       ## imm = 0xFFFFFFFF
        andq    32(%rdi), %rax
        shlq    $32, %rcx
        addq    %rax, %rcx
        movq    %rcx, 32(%rdi)

and each of the testcases into a single store.  Each of them used
to compile into craziness like this:

_test4:
	movl	$65535, %eax            ## imm = 0xFFFF
	andl	(%rdi), %eax
	shll	$16, %esi
	addl	%eax, %esi
	movl	%esi, (%rdi)
	ret

8d17160e2c Teach MachineSinking to handle easy critical edges.
Sometimes it is desirable to sink instructions along a critical edge:

x = ...
if (a && b) ...
else use(x);

The 'a && b' condition creates a critical edge to the else block, but we still
want to sink the computation of x into the block. The else block is dominated by
the parent block, so we are not pushing instructions into new code paths.

2ad4aca8b2 If we mark clean-ups as clean-ups, then it could break when inlining through an
'invoke' instruction. You will get a situation like this:

bb:
  %ehptr = eh.exception()
  %sel = eh.selector(%ehptr, @per, 0);

...

bb2:
  invoke _Unwind_Resume_or_Rethrow(%ehptr) %normal unwind to %lpad

lpad:
  ...

The unwinder will see the %sel call as a clean-up and, if it doesn't have a
catch further up the call stack, it will skip running it. But there *is* another
catch up the stack -- the catch for the %lpad. However, we can't see that. This
is fixed in code-gen, where we detect this situation, and convert the "clean-up"
selector call into a "catch-all" selector call. This gives us the correct
semantics.

bfcb305189 Change how dbg_value sdnodes are converted into machine instructions. Their placement should be determined by the relative order of incoming llvm instructions. The scheduler will now use the SDNode ordering information to determine where to insert them. A dbg_value instruction is inserted after the instruction with the last highest source order and before the instruction with the next highest source order. It will optimize the placement by inserting right after the instruction that produces the value if they have consecutive order numbers.
Here is a theoretical example that illustrates why the placement is important.

tmp1 = 
store tmp1 -> x
...
tmp2 = add ...
...
call
...
store tmp2 -> x

Now mem2reg comes along:

tmp1 = 
dbg_value (tmp1 -> x)
...
tmp2 = add ...
...
call
...
dbg_value (tmp2 -> x)

When the debugger examine the value of x after the add instruction but before the call, it should have the value of tmp1.

Furthermore, for dbg_value's that reference constants, they should not be emitted at the beginning of the block (since they do not have "producers").

This patch also cleans up how SDISel manages DbgValue nodes. It allow a SDNode to be referenced by multiple SDDbgValue nodes. When a SDNode is deleted, it uses the information to find the SDDbgValues and invalidate them. They are not deleted until the corresponding SelectionDAG is destroyed.

80d23705e6 Stop trying to merge identical jump tables. This had been inadvertently
disabled for several months (since svn r88806) and no one noticed.  My fix
for pr6543 yesterday reenabled it, but broke the ARM port's code for using
TBB/TBH.  Rather than adding a target hook to disable merging for Thumb2 only,
I'm just taking this out.  It is not common to have identical jump tables,
the code we used to merge them was O(N^2), and it only helps code size, not
performance.

d1ec31dca5 Fix pr6543: svn r88806 changed MachineJumpTableInfo::getJumpTableIndex() to
always create a new jump table.  The intention was to avoid merging jump
tables in SelectionDAGBuilder, and to wait for the branch folding pass to
merge tables.  Unfortunately, the same getJumpTableIndex() method is also
used to merge tables in branch folding, so as a result of this change
branch tables are never merged.  Worse, the branch folding code is expecting
getJumpTableIndex to always return the index of an existing table, but with
this change, it never does so.  In at least some cases, e.g., pr6543, this
creates references to non-existent tables.

I've fixed the problem by adding a new createJumpTableIndex function, which
will always create a new table, and I've changed getJumpTableIndex to only
look at existing tables.

2938a00f29 Add a couple more heuristics to neuter machine cse some more.
1. Be careful with cse "cheap" expressions. e.g. constant materialization. Only cse them when the common expression is local or in a direct predecessor. We don't want cse of cheap instruction causing other expressions to be spilled.
2. Watch out for the case where the expression doesn't itself uses a virtual register. e.g. lea of frame object. If the common expression itself is used by copies (common for passing addresses to function calls), don't perform the cse. Since these expressions do not use a register, it creates a live range but doesn't close any, we want to be very careful with increasing register pressure.

Note these are heuristics so machine cse doesn't make register allocator unhappy. Once we have proper live range splitting and re-materialization support in place, these should be evaluated again.

Now machine cse is almost always a win on llvm nightly tests on x86 and x86_64.

35071a0847 Disable physical register coalescing when the number of live ranges for the
physreg becomes ridiculously high.

std::upper_bound may be log(N), but for sufficiently large live intervals, it
becomes log(N)*cachemiss = a long long time.

This patch improves coalescer time by 4500x for a function with 20000
function calls. The generated code is different, but not significantly worse -
the allocator hints are almost as good as physreg coalescing anyway.

53e000bac3 Better handling of dead super registers in LiveVariables. We used to do this:
CALL ... %RAX<imp-def>
   ... [not using %RAX]
   %EAX = ..., %RAX<imp-use, kill>
   RET %EAX<imp-use,kill>

Now we do this:

   CALL ... %RAX<imp-def, dead>
   ... [not using %RAX]
   %EAX = ...
   RET %EAX<imp-use,kill>

By not artificially keeping %RAX alive, we lower register pressure a bit.

7d9f2b93a3 This test case:
long test(long x) { return (x & 123124) | 3; }

Currently compiles to:

_test:
        orl     $3, %edi
        movq    %rdi, %rax
        andq    $123127, %rax
        ret

This is because instruction and DAG combiners canonicalize

  (or (and x, C), D) -> (and (or, D), (C | D))

However, this is only profitable if (C & D) != 0. It gets in the way of the
3-addressification because the input bits are known to be zero.
